namespace zelos
Class
Kelas | Deskripsi |
---|---|
BottomRow | Objek yang berisi informasi tentang elemen apa yang ada di baris bawah blok serta informasi spasi untuk baris atas. Elemen di baris bawah dapat terdiri dari sudut, pengatur jarak, dan koneksi berikutnya. |
ConstantProvider | Objek yang menyediakan konstanta untuk merender blok dalam mode Zelos. |
Panel samping | Objek yang menggambar blok berdasarkan informasi rendering yang diberikan. |
PathObject | Objek yang menangani pembuatan dan penetapan setiap elemen SVG yang digunakan oleh perender. |
Renderer | Perender zelos. Perender ini mengemulasikan rendering gaya Scratch dan MakeCode. Zelos adalah semangat persaingan dan emulasi Yunani kuno. |
RenderInfo | Objek yang berisi semua informasi ukuran yang diperlukan untuk menggambar blok ini. Penerusan pengukuran ini tidak menyebarkan perubahan ke blok (meskipun kolom dapat memilih untuk merender ulang saat getSize() dipanggil). Namun, memanggilnya berulang kali mungkin mahal. |
RightConnectionShape | Objek yang berisi informasi tentang ruang yang digunakan bentuk koneksi kanan selama rendering. |
StatementInput | Objek yang berisi informasi tentang ruang yang digunakan input pernyataan selama rendering. |
TopRow | Objek yang berisi informasi tentang elemen yang ada di baris atas blok serta informasi ukuran untuk baris atas. Elemen di baris atas dapat terdiri dari sudut, topi, pengatur jarak, dan koneksi sebelumnya. Setelah konstruktor ini dipanggil, baris akan berisi semua elemen non-pengisi spasi yang diperlukan. |